Default AC question after install

hey guys, i just have a quick question. i have just installed a whole new AC system into my camaro and now have to take it to a shop to have vacumed/flushed/filled with freon. i have put the correct amount of oil into the compressor and dryer. Is it ok if i hook everything back up and drive it to the shop without the AC on? i dont want to destroy the new compressor and the orphice tube. please let me know of any suggestions or fixes.

So if you're worried about turning on the compressor just don't plug it in. Holy everything together and you will be good. Don't forget your compressor will engage also if you have the selector on defrost.
